Tesla has introduced a new accessory for Model Y owners, the J1772 Adapter Door Dock, designed to bring convenience when getting ready to charge your car at non-Tesla chargers.
This innovative dock is crafted to fit perfectly within the driver’s side door pocket, providing a secure storage solution for the charging adapter when not in use. Typically, without this dock the adapter sits loose in the door dock, or even in the bottom of your trunk’s side cubby.
The Model Y J1772 Adapter Door Dock ensures that drivers have easy and quick access to their charging adapter whenever needed, enhancing the overall convenience of electric vehicle charging. The package includes one J1772 Adapter Door Dock, though it’s important to note that the J1772 adapter itself is not included.
This new accessory is compatible with all Tesla Model Y vehicles, offering a seamless integration for Tesla owners looking to optimize their charging experience. We’ll have one coming our way soon and share our thoughts on how this adapter, priced at $25 USD ($35 in Canada) with free shipping, performs.
